1. Filing a Claim

The first step in the legal process is filing a claim. This is where you will notify the other party that you intend to file a lawsuit. The claim will include a demand for compensation, giving the other party a chance to respond. If they refuse to pay or make an offer that is significantly lower than what you are asking for, you can file a lawsuit.

A lawsuit is a formal legal process that is used to resolve disputes. It is important to note that not all disputes need to be resolved through a lawsuit. Most cases are settled out of court. However, filing a lawsuit may be your best option if the other party is unwilling to negotiate in good faith.

An experienced lawyer will be able to advise you on whether or not filing a lawsuit is the best course of action for your case. This includes taking into account the strength of your case, the amount of money you seek, and the likelihood of success. They will guide you through the process and help you understand what to expect from the court system, opposing counsel, and the judge.

3. Investigate Your Claim

A lawyer can unearth significant evidence and develop a strong legal strategy by thoroughly investigating your claim. In addition, a reasonable investigation can help identify potential weaknesses in your case and allow you to address them before the other side exploits them.

The investigation begins with reviewing all relevant documentation, such as police reports, medical records, and eyewitness statements. Once this information has been gathered, your lawyer may conduct interviews with key witnesses. This is often done to obtain sworn statements from witnesses who can attest to the events in question. Sometimes, your lawyer may hire experts to provide testimony or opinion evidence.

You may be blindsided by new evidence or caught off guard by an opposing expert witness without a thorough investigation. By taking the time to investigate your claim, a lawyer can help to give you the best chance of success.

4. Determine if You Have a Case

This may seem simple, but it requires much knowledge and experience. Your lawyer will evaluate the facts of your case and compare them to the law. If there is a good chance that you will be successful, your lawyer will then begin to build a strong legal strategy.

They can also investigate the other party involved to see if they may have been negligent. For example, if you were injured in a car accident, your lawyer will investigate to see if the other driver was speeding or if they were distracted. If you were injured in a gym, your lawyer would investigate to see if the equipment was well-maintained or if there were any safety hazards.

Your lawyer can question any witness to determine what happened and how it will impact your case. They can also review any security footage to understand better what happened. If they don’t have access to it, they will subpoena it.

Your lawyer will also obtain copies of any relevant laws or regulations. All of this evidence will be used to build a strong case on your behalf. By taking the time to determine whether or not you have a case, your lawyer can help you avoid costly and time-consuming litigation.

5. Calculating Your Damages

There are many factors to consider when calculating your damages. Your lawyer will consider your present and future medical bills and lost wages. If you cannot return to work, your lawyer will factor in any loss of earning potential. They will also consider the pain and suffering you have endured because of your injuries. An experienced lawyer will know how to maximize compensation to get back on your feet after an accident.

One of the first things a lawyer will do is review your medical records to get a complete picture of your injuries. They will then work with medical experts to determine the extent of your injuries and how long it will take you to recover.

This is important information because it will help the lawyer calculate your medical bills and lost wages. In addition, the lawyer will also consider the impact your injuries have had on your quality of life. If you’ve been in pain or unable to enjoy your hobbies because of your injuries, the lawyer will ensure that these losses are considered.
